About the doctor

Prof. Dr. med. Christian von Bary is an accomplished doctor specializing in internal medicine, rhythmology, interventional cardiology, and emergency medicine. He has an impressive educational background, having studied medicine at the Ludwig-Maximilians-University in Munich, Germany, and England, South Africa, and the USA. With extensive experience in the field, he has worked in renowned medical institutions such as the German Heart Center in Munich and the Red Cross Hospital in Munich, where he currently serves as the Chief Physician in the Department of Internal Medicine - Cardiology and Pneumology. Dr. von Bary's career is further distinguished by his contributions to scientific research, with over 52 published papers. His research focuses on various aspects of cardiology, including surgical and interventional therapy strategies in atrial fibrillation, microwave ablation of atrial fibrillation, and evaluating pulmonary vein stenosis. Being a member of prestigious medical societies such as the German Society for Cardiology and the European Society of Cardiology, Dr. von Bary stays at the forefront of advancements in his field. With his extensive expertise, dedication, and commitment to advancing cardiology, Dr. von Bary is highly regarded and recognized as a skilled professional. He continues to provide exceptional care to his patients at the Red Cross Hospital in Munich and contributes valuable research to the medical community.

Resume

CV (Curriculum Vitae)

Education
  • Studied medicine at the Ludwig-Maximilians-University in Munich, Germany
  • Studied in England, South Africa, USA
  • Specialist in internal medicine, cardiology
  • Specialist in rhythmology, interventional cardiology, emergency medicine
Experience
  • Internship at the Medical Clinic I, University Hospital Groshadern of the Ludwig-Maximilians-University Munich, Germany
  • Doctorate on the topic: “Investigations on the initiation of paroxysmal atrial fibrillation using novel pacemaker technology”
  • Resident in the Department of Cardiovascular Surgery, German Heart Center Munich, Germany
  • Resident and Senior Physician at the Clinic for Cardiovascular Diseases, German Heart Center Munich, and Clinic rechts der Isar of the Technical University of Munich, Germany
  • Senior physician in cardiology and senior physician in electrophysiology at the Clinic and Polyclinic for Internal Medicine II, University Hospital Regensburg, Germany
  • Habilitation on the topic “Evaluation of surgical and interventional therapy strategies in atrial fibrillation”, University Hospital Regensburg, Germany
  • Senior consultant in cardiology at the Red Cross Clinic in Munich, Germany
  • 2013 Chief Physician of the Department of Internal Medicine I - Cardiology and Pneumology at the Red Cross Hospital in Munich, Germany
  • 2018 Adjunct professor at the University of Regensburg, Germany
Awards & Memberships
  • Member of the German Society for Cardiology
  • Member of the European Society of Cardiology
  • Member of the European Heart Rhythm Association
